データ集録用語
ハードウェア: Multifunction DAQ (MIO)
問題:
データ集録処理の速さに関するサンプリング用語が多くて困っています。Sample Clock、Sample Rate、Convert Clock、Convert Rate、Channel List、Scan、Interval Scanning、Interchannel Delay などの用語の定義は何ですか?
解決策:
NI-DAQ 7.0 には、NI-Switch、従来型NI-DAQ および NI-DAQmxの3種類のドライバが含まれています。NI-DAQmx は新しいデータ集録アーキテクチャを導入し、同時に新しい用語を使用するようになりました。用語を変更した目的は、LabVIEW と C言語の API との間で一貫性を向上させるためです。従来型 NI-DAQ の用語と、NI-DAQmx の LabVIEW と C API の用語の対応表を以下に記載します。詳細な対応表については、スタート » プログラム » National Instruments » NI-DAQ » NI-DAQmxヘルプの『
従来型NI-DAQ(レガシー)とNI-DAQmxでの用語変更』の項目を参照してください。
以下の用語はサンプリングの説明でよく使用されています。用語集に進む前に、まず最初の用語表を理解しておく必要があります。用語集では基本的に NI-DAQmx の用語を使用することに注意してください。対応する従来型 NI-DAQ 用語は括弧内に表記します。
従来型 NI-DAQ C API |
従来型 NI-DAQ LabVIEW |
NI-DAQmx |
説明 |
Scan Interval Counter |
Scan Clock |
Sample Clock |
サンプリングの時間間隔を制御するクロック。Sample Clockのパルスが発生する度に、各チャンネルあたり1サンプル集録します。Sample Clock の信号源は、データ集録(DAQ)ボードの内部タイマか、外部クロック信号で生成されます。 |
Scans per Second |
Scans per Second |
Samples per Channel per Second |
サンプル集録レート(単位時間あたりの集録数)を指定する単位 |
Sample Interval Counter |
Channel Clock or Interchannel Delay |
Convert Clock |
E シリーズDAQデバイスにおいて、アナログ/デジタル変換のタイミングを直接決定するクロック。デフォルトでは、Convert Clock Rateは NI-DAQ ドライバソフトウェアが自動的に計算します。また、データ集録ボードの内部タイマや外部信号を設定することで、Convert Clock Rateを明示的に指定することもできます。 |
Points per Second |
Channels per Second |
Conversions per Second |
Convert Clock Rate(単位時間あたりの Convert Clock) |
注意:
- 非プラグ・アンド・プレイ(レガシー)DAQ ボードには Sample (Scan) Clock がなく、Convert (Channel) Clock のみである製品があります。この種類のボードはラウンド・ロビン・サンプリング(下記リンク参照)を使用しています。
- 弊社の同時サンプリングボードは Sample (Scan) Clock のみです。同時サンプリングボードはマルチプレクスを利用しないため、Convert (Channel) Clock はありません。
Channel List (Scan List)
サンプルするチャンネルのリストのこと。
Scan
サンプルの集合で、Channel List に含まれる各チャンネルをサンプルすること。
Interval Scanning
複数チャンネル・サンプリングの方法のひとつ。Sample (Scan) Clock で Scan を開始するタイミングを制御し、Convert (Channel) Clock で、Channel List の各チャンネルのサンプルタイミングを制御します。
Sample/Sampling Rate (Scan Rate)
各チャンネルにおける集録レート(単位時間あたりの集録数)のこと。Sample (Scan) Clock が設定されたレート。E シリーズDAQボードの仕様上、最大 Sampling Rate は、1チャンネルでの最大レートになります。たとえば、PCI-6071E は Sampling Rate 1.25 MS/s で動作します。これは 1 チャンネルなら 1.25 MS/s で集録し、5 チャンネルなら 250 kS/s で集録するという意味です。単位は、Samples per Channel per Second (Scans per Second) です。
Convert Rate (Channel Rate)
アナログ/デジタル変換するレート(単位時間あたりの回数)のこと。これは Convert (Channel) Clock のレートです。単位は、Conversions per Second (Channels per Second)です。
Interchannel Delay
Channel List の連続するチャンネルの集録と集録の時間のこと。Convert Rate が Interchannel Delay になります。Interchannel Delay は、Sample Clock の間に Channel List のすべてのチャンネルをサンプルできる程度に短く設定しておくべきです。Interchannel Delay が長くなると、増幅器が次の読み取りまでに、より安定します。(関連リンクを参照)
データ集録のサンプルプログラムは、NI-DAQドライバとともにインストールされるサンプルプログラムや、Developer Zone から検索することができます。
関連リンク: 技術サポートデータベース 30LDURMV: スキャンクロック(サンプルクロック)とチャンネルクロック(コンバートクロック)の違い
技術サポートデータベース 2XPE1QCW: 従来型NI-DAQの”チャネルクロック”にあたる、NI-DAQmxの”Convert Clock Rate”はどのように定義されていますか?
技術サポートデータベース 1Z5D23PH: NI-DAQ 7.x用データ集録マニュアルリンク集
技術サポートデータベース 1DAIG7W3: インターバルサンプリングとラウンドロビンサンプリングの違い
Developer Zoneチュートリアル: Is Your Data Inaccurate Because of Instrumentation Amplifier Settling Time?
添付:
報告日時: 09/07/2001
最終更新日: 07/16/2012
ドキュメントID: 2D6CTML8
Other Support Options
Ask the NI Community
Collaborate with other users in our discussion forums
Request Support from an Engineer
A valid service agreement may be required, and support options vary by country.